我在使用正则表达式匹配的RichTextBox(WinForms)中选择文本时遇到问题。
正确选择了第一行,但第二行,第三行,......,N行移动了所选文本。我怀疑罪魁祸首是'\ n',但我不知道如何解决它。
foreach (Match m in mColl)
{
this.rtbContent.Select(m.Index, m.Length);
this.rtbContent.SelectionBackColor = Color.Tomato;
}
我的正则表达式是[a-zA-Z]。
例:
测试
测试
测试
第一次测试没问题,但是secont将选择est,第三次测试将是st。